Welcome to this spacious and beautifully updated family home in the highly desirable Fox Hollow community of North London. Freshly painted throughout, this impressive 4+2 bedroom, 3.5 bathroom home offers over 3,700 sq. ft. of finished living space with a practical layout suited to families and professionals. The bright foyer features large windows and high ceilings. Hardwood flooring runs throughout the main and upper levels, including the bedrooms. The spacious kitchen offers granite countertops, a centre island, dark cabinetry, backsplash, gas stove and stainless steel appliances. The generously sized living room features a gas fireplace. The upper level includes four well-sized bedrooms. The spacious primary bedroom features a walk-in closet and a private five-piece ensuite with double sinks, a glass shower and a separate bathtub. The fully finished walk-up basement provides two additional bedrooms, a full kitchen, a full bathroom, brand-new vinyl flooring and a large recreation room with a second gas fireplace. This flexible space is ideal for extended family, guests or additional living space. The property also features a large, fully fenced backyard with a freshly painted deck, providing an excellent space for relaxing and entertaining. A double-car garage and ample driveway parking add further convenience. Located in a sought-after, family-friendly neighbourhood close to schools, parks, trails, shopping, restaurants and everyday amenities. How the rating is calculated
EQAO — Ontario’s testing agency — publishes, for each school, the percentage of students meeting the provincial standard in Grade 3 and Grade 6 reading, writing and mathematics. The rating is the average of those percentages divided by ten. A school where 72% of students met the standard rates 7.2 out of 10.
Nothing is weighted or adjusted, and schools are not ranked against each other. Where EQAO withholds a result to protect the privacy of a small group of students, that measure is left out rather than counted as zero — so a rating built on fewer than six measures says so.
What it does not measure. It is one year of standardised testing in three subjects. It says nothing about teaching, programs, or whether a school suits a particular child, and it tracks neighbourhood household income closely enough that it partly measures the neighbourhood rather than the school. Treat it as one figure among many.

How these are built, and what they cannot tell you
Each point is the median of the leases that closed in that quarter among detached houses in london north. A quarter with fewer than eight is left out rather than drawn, and the line breaks where that happens — a median over three sales is really one home’s price, and joining across a gap would draw a number nobody measured.
This is not an estimate of what this home is worth. The segment is a property type in an area; it takes no account of this home’s size, condition, renovations, lot, exposure or how it compares to its neighbours, and half the homes in any quarter sold for more than the median and half for less. It is context for a conversation with an agent, not a valuation.
